Shoppes at Union Hill Fashion Show
August 10, 2004

Fashion for a United Cause

On Tuesday, August 10, over 200 people came out to view the latest fall fashions, to enjoy a wonderful meal, and to help raise money for United Way of Morris County's Women Helping Women campaign. Mizar Turdiu, the former morning news anchor for News 12 New Jersey, was a hit as the event's emcee.

The Shoppes at Union Hill in Denville co-hosted the evening with United Way of Morris County. Mr. and Miss Denville graced the runway along with other enthusiastic community volunteer models, showing off the latest fashions from Gap, Banana Republic, Ann Taylor Loft, Jos. A. Bank, Talbotts, Chico's, Elizabeth, and Children's Place. Bensi catered the delicious dinner, while Starbucks and Panera Bread donated their tasty treats.

Grover Kemble, a multi-talented New Jersey guitarist, vocalist and jazz performer, entertained the crowd before the show and as the models walked down the runway. The Tricky Tray table was a huge success. Proceeds from the twenty-two items that were generously donated, will go toward the Women Helping Women campaign.
